SEVEN-MINUTE MICROTALKS ARE A NEW OPTION FOR BMES ANNUAL MEETING PRESENTERS

The 2020 BMES Annual Meeting will pilot microtalks for 3 sessions at this year's event in San Diego, October 14-17.

Microtalks will be 7 minutes long and each session will feature about 8 talks. If you are interested in doing a micro talk, please select that option when submitting an abstract for the meeting. Researchers who express interest in doing a microtalk will be offered the option of presenting one instead of a poster. 

After all abstracts are submitted, the meeting chairs will work with track chairs to select microtalks. The microtalks will occur in a theater in the exhibitor hall on Thursday or Friday of the meeting.
